Web3. jan 2024 · Gardeners can also use a combination of natural and organic solutions to control pest infestations on hibiscus plants. Companion planting can be used to repel pests from hibiscus plants. Planting garlic, chives, or peppermint near hibiscus plants can repel aphids and other pests. Web20. feb 2024 · Galls. Whitney Cranshaw, Colorado State University, Bugwood.org. Phylloxera galls are up to 5/8 inch long hollow green growths caused by aphid-like insects called phylloxera.
